
Irakere is a Cuban band formed in 1973, known for blending Latin American music with jazz. Founded by pianist Chucho Valdés, the group became a cornerstone of Afro-Cuban jazz, incorporating elements of traditional Cuban rhythms, funk, and classical music. Irakere gained international recognition after signing with Columbia Records and winning a Grammy Award in 1980 for Best Latin Recording. Their iconic tracks include "Bacalao Con Pan" and "Misa Negra". The band’s innovative approach has left a lasting impact on the evolution of Latin jazz, influencing countless musicians worldwide.
